iCloud Photos not Showing on Mac but show on iPhone

I have thousands of photos and videos on my iphone going back more than 10 years. They are set to backup to my icloud and all works well. I have the same iCloud account signed in on my Mac but in the photos app iCloud is not checked. So there is no sync between photos and iCloud on the Mac. In the photo app library , there are only about 15 images visible, compated to the thousands in the photos app on my phone.


I was thinking to check / turn on iCloud in the photos app on the Mac, but I am concerned that these 15 images might replace the thousands of images that are already synced to my icloud account from my phone.


Any suggestions how I can see the phone images on my Mac?

iCloud Photos keeps all the devices' Libraries the same. So if you turn on iCloud on your Mac, the Mac's pictures will be added to iCloud and to your phone, and the pictures at iCloud will be added to your Mac. Nothing will be erased.


You will need to have enough room in your Mac's storage for all those pictures, otherwise weird things can happen. If you don't have enough room, you can turn on "Optimize Storage," and only smaller versions will be transferred to the Mac. I don't use Optimize on my Mac, because I want backups to include full sized information.
